The Lies We Tell Ourselves
“I do not earn enough.” You do not need to earn enough to buy a mansion. You need to earn enough to start. A plot of land. A savings habit. A Tier 3 pension. Small steps compound into life-changing outcomes.
“Property is for rich people.” Property is how many rich people became rich. The question is not whether you can afford to invest in property. The question is whether you can afford not to — while rent eats 30-40% of your income every month with zero return.
“I will do it later.” Later is the most expensive word in property. The plot that costs GHS 50,000 today will cost GHS 100,000 in three years. The house that costs GHS 500,000 now will cost GHS 750,000 by the time “later” arrives. Every year you wait, the goal moves further away.

The Compound Effect
GHS 500 per month at 25% Treasury bill return grows to approximately GHS 42,000 in 5 years. GHS 1,000 per month becomes GHS 84,000. Add your Tier 2 pension access and you are looking at GHS 100,000-150,000 — enough for a land purchase and construction start in several Accra corridors.
